Get the Medical Attention You Are In Need of

If you're involved in a crash involving a truck, it is crucial to seek the medical attention you require. The proper treatment and checking in with your doctor can make all the difference in how quickly you recover from your injuries, and it can also help ensure that you get fair compensation for your injuries.

One of the most frequent errors that injury victims do is to wait for their injuries to heal up on their own. This can cause serious problems in the future. A lot of accidents cause injuries that aren't visible or obvious immediately following the incident. Injuries like internal bleeding and trauma to the brain typically do not manifest for days or even hours after the incident. They can become more severe if they are neglected.

In addition, if you delay treatment, it could lead the insurance company to reject your claim and pay for your injuries. A doctor can conduct diagnostic tests and provide you with a thorough examinations to identify your injuries. They can also recommend treatments and rest times to aid in healing and stop further injuries from occurring.

Take pictures of the accident Scene



Taking photos of the accident scene and its surroundings can be crucial to your case. Photographs can provide investigators with specific information that can help them to piece together information and answer questions on who is responsible.

Additionally, the best photos will also help you create an image of the way the incident unfolded and show how much damage was done to the vehicles involved. This is a useful tool when you're talking to the insurance company of the other driver or testifying in court.

While it's not always possible to take pictures at the scene of an accident, if you can, do so as soon as it's safe for you to do so. The ideal scenario is while you wait for emergency vehicles to arrive or before your vehicle is removed.

After you've snapped some general images of the scene, begin taking close-ups to show the damage to your vehicle and any other items damaged in the collision. It is possible to take pictures of the license plate of the vehicle along with its interior as well as any other parts that may be damaged or bloodstains.

You can also take photos of other objects, including signs and roadways. For instance, if there was a traffic sign close to the scene of the accident that was damaged or broken in the crash, snap a photo of it as well.

Also, be sure to take photos of any weather conditions present at the time of the crash. This is because if the person at fault says that the crash occurred due to an icy road then the pictures will disprove their claim and could make a huge difference in your case.

In some cases it's better to get another person who was in the vehicle to take photographs for you if you're able to do so yourself. This is because you could be too lightheaded or injured to walk around the accident scene on your own.

Hire an Attorney

It is important to retain an attorney as soon as you learn of a truck accident when you've been injured. The sooner you act, the better chance you have of obtaining the compensation you deserve for your medical bills, your property damage and other costs caused by your injuries.

Your legal team will try to identify all parties who may be responsible for your injuries. This will usually involve an in-depth analysis of the causes of the collision.

It is important to establish liability because it will determine the amount of money you will receive from a settlement or lawsuit. Your attorney must be able demonstrate that the person who caused your accident acted negligently and violated his obligation of duty of care to others.

It could be anything from a driver speeding up or driving under the influence, to the trucking firm failing to perform an extensive background check prior to hiring the driver, or allowing him to drive for longer than what law allows for in the state and federal laws.

Other parties that may be accountable for your accident could be the manufacturer of the vehicle and the person who loaded the cargo. Your lawyer for truck accidents will be able to determine who is responsible for the accident and the amount you could get.

In fatal truck accidents the wrongful death claim can be filed. The family members of those killed in these crashes can be awarded damages for lost income medical bills, as well as other expenses.
